1964: A young boy in a vintage Little League uniform takes a swing at a pitch during a summer game in Dayton, Ohio. The 8mm film captures the authentic atmosphere of a 1960s neighborhood baseball game, with the batter missing a bad pitch, the umpire in position, and spectators watching from the sidelines. The footage shows classic 1960s fashion, team uniforms, and the excitement of youth sports on a sunny Saturday.
